What is the correct formula of washing soda?
Correct Answer: D. Na₂CO₃.10H₂O
Explanation: The correct formula for washing soda is Na2CO3.10H2O, which corresponds to option D. Chemically known as sodium carbonate decahydrate, washing soda is a crystalline salt containing ten molecules of water of crystallization for every unit of sodium carbonate. While anhydrous sodium carbonate (Na2CO3) is called soda ash, the specific hydrated form used for domestic cleaning and laundry is the decahydrate.
